Law firm announces new managing partner

Law firm  DWF has announced partner Mike Renshaw has announced a new managing partner at its Bristol office.

Mr Renshaw joined the firm in 2021 as a partner in the global major injury and casualty insurance practice in Southampton.

With over two decades of experience in defendant insurance litigation, serving insurers and their individual and corporate policyholders Renshaw has a history of building and nurturing high-performing teams.

Hr will be taking over the of leading a team of 100 at DWF’s Bristol office, taking the reins from Simon Mason, who was managing from the office’s inception in 2011 and is retiring from the business at the end of February 2024.

Mr Renshaw said: “I am really excited about my new role as managing partner and delighted to have the opportunity to return to Bristol and work with the talented team to deliver the next phase of our journey.

“Bristol is superbly located to serve clients in Wales, the South and South West of England and is well connected to London. We already offer a wide range of services to clients including claims management and adjusting, defendant personal injury, abuse, HSE and criminal defence, GDPR, professional indemnity and subrogated recovery, and intend to grow these and other areas substantially over the next four years.”
